Remote Data Analyst III - AI-Assisted Analytics
About the Role
We are looking for a Remote Data Analyst III to join our team at SkySlope and help elevate the way we leverage data across the organization. This role is not just about traditional data retrieval and reporting; it’s about proactively identifying trends, surfacing insights, and making recommendations that help teams make informed decisions before they even know to ask. If you’re passionate about data and want to make a real impact, this is the role for you!
What You'll Do
- Query, extract, and transform data from multiple sources across MS SQL Server, MySQL, and MongoDB to support business needs.
- Build and maintain automated reports, dashboards, and data pipelines that enhance data accessibility and reduce manual efforts.
- Partner with cross-functional teams to understand their goals and deliver analytical insights that drive action.
- Identify patterns, trends, anomalies, and opportunities in data sets, communicating findings clearly to both technical and non-technical audiences.
- Develop and maintain Python scripts for data automation, transformation, reporting, and analysis.
- Contribute to improving our data infrastructure, documentation, and analytical best practices.
- Explore opportunities to incorporate AI-powered tools and techniques into existing workflows where they add clear value.
Requirements
- 5+ years of experience in a data analyst or similar role with progressive responsibility.
- Advanced SQL proficiency across both MS SQL Server and MySQL, including complex joins, stored procedures, and query optimization.
- Proficiency in Python for scripting, data manipulation, and automation (familiarity with libraries like pandas and NumPy is a plus).
- Experience with BI/visualization tools such as Tableau, Power BI, or Looker.
- Strong communication skills to translate analytical findings into actionable recommendations for stakeholders.
- Self-directed mindset with a history of proactively surfacing insights and improving processes.
Nice to Have
- Familiarity with cloud platforms (Azure, AWS, or GCP).
- Exposure to machine learning concepts or AI-assisted analytics tools.
- Experience with A/B testing, statistical modeling, or causal inference.
- Knowledge of version control (Git) and collaborative development workflows.
- Real estate industry knowledge or experience.
What We Offer
- Competitive salary range of $100,000 - $120,000 per year.
- Comprehensive medical, dental, and vision insurance plans.
- 401(k) plan with company match.
- Paid time off (120 hours) and 16 paid holidays.
